Starts educational project from Opera Software

Today officially launched a new educational project from the company Opera Software. Under the new program, the company's employees together with leading experts from Yahoo! A series of articles on web standards and their use in development, on the use of HTML and CSS, on how to use JavaScript, and much more has been prepared (and will be updated). All educational institutions are free to use these educational materials under the terms of the Creative Commons license. But that's not all.

In addition to educational materials, all interested universities, colleges and schools will be able to get the whole set of software developed by Opera Software for free - Opera browser for desktops, browser for mobile phones Opera Mini and browser Opera Mobile for smartphones and PDAs running Windows Mobile and Symbian.

Also in the fall, Opera Software company experts are planning to visit with lectures some universities in countries such as Germany, China, Russia, Japan, Brazil and others (there are 10 countries scheduled for university tours). In the future we plan to conduct similar lectures on a regular basis.
